Inpatient drug rehab is also commonly called residential addiction treatment. In inpatient residential treatment, you will live in the treatment center while receiving treatment. The duration of your stay will vary depending on the program that you choose.
On average, most people spend around 30 days in such a facility. However, you can also stay much longer in some programs - with some going over and above the 90 day mark. In many cases, the duration will largely depend on how serious your addiction is, if you have already been through rehab before, as well as if you are diagnosed with any mental health disorders.

Many of these inpatient centers will attempt to provide you with a rigorous and comprehensive treatment plan to ensure that you address the physical, emotional, and behavioral aspects of your substance abuse problem. The program might also prove useful if you have been diagnosed with a co-occurring mental health disorder.
That said, all inpatient substance abuse treatment facilities in Marshall county will offer unique accommodations and services. While some will have rudimentary shared rooms, community facilities, and cafeteria style meals, others will offer private rooms, gourmet meals, and many other convenient amenities such as gyms, spas, and pools.
